1. Ditch the office elevator and hit the stairs!

Working out doesn’t have to mean splashing out on expensive gyms. As they say, the only gym you need is a good staircase –  it’s true that stair climbing is a vigorous exercise that has more health benefits than you think and burns more calories per minute than jogging. You’d be surprised to know that you burn about 0.42 calories for every step you climb – that’s around 15 calories per three flights of stairs! Need I say more, ya aap convince hogaye?

4. Unplug from technology an hour before bed

Put all your gadgets away an hour before you go to bed! Using your phone at night not only irks your mom and dad but it also interferes with the production of the sleep hormone, melatonin. The blue light emitted by the LED screens also leads to insomnia and weak eyesight in the future.
